A novel ZnO nanorod/nanoparticle (NR/NP) hierarchical structure on a zinc foil has been fabricated through a chemical bath deposition method. When used as a flexible photoanode for DSSCs, such a structure demonstrated enhanced dye-loading and electron lifetime as compared to the NR structure. It also retarded the charge recombination while maintaining the electron diffusion length of the NR structure. As a result, the power conversion efficiency of the DSSCs based on the NR/NP structure increased from 1.35% to 3.63% with a 169% enhancement as compared to that based on ZnO NRs.
